Output dfba4bbf35b0101c6fc970622da6b24ea56715e2f5ec805171afeffe97a9a3e1:28

value
6409591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d3a12c8a992918dc3ebca36fd74c1ced866a38c OP_EQUAL
address
MDUu297LqNPtmwXcrRQxEUMkS8GGMJC4zm
transaction
dfba4bbf35b0101c6fc970622da6b24ea56715e2f5ec805171afeffe97a9a3e1
spent
true